Understanding Insecurity and Its Impact

Insecurity stems from feelings of inadequacy, self-doubt, and fear of rejection or failure. It often manifests as a lack of self-confidence and an excessive need for reassurance from others. Insecurity can be triggered by past experiences, negative self-talk, or comparisons to others. It can lead to anxiety, low self-esteem, and difficulty in forming healthy relationships. Addressing insecurity requires introspection and self-awareness to identify the underlying fears and beliefs that contribute to these feelings.

Recognizing Signs of Insecurity

Some common signs of insecurity include constant self-criticism, seeking validation from others, avoiding new challenges or risks, and feeling envious of others’ success. Insecurity can also manifest as perfectionism, people-pleasing behavior, or an inability to assert oneself. Being aware of these signs can help individuals acknowledge their insecurities and take steps to address them.

Practical Steps to Overcome Insecurity

  1. Challenge negative beliefs: Identify and challenge the negative beliefs about yourself that contribute to feelings of insecurity. Replace them with positive affirmations and realistic self-perceptions.
  2. Practice self-compassion: Be kind and understanding towards yourself, especially in moments of self-doubt or criticism.
  3. Step out of your comfort zone: Take on new challenges and experiences to build confidence and resilience.
  4. Seek feedback and validation internally: Instead of relying on external validation, learn to validate your own worth and achievements.
  5. Focus on personal growth: Invest in self-improvement and learning opportunities to boost self-esteem and confidence.

Techniques for Managing Negative Thoughts

  1. Mindfulness meditation: Practice mindfulness techniques to observe and detach from negative thoughts without judgment.
  2. Cognitive-behavioral therapy: Work with a therapist to identify and challenge negative thought patterns and replace them with more positive and realistic beliefs.
  3. Journaling: Write down your thoughts and feelings to gain insight into your thought processes and emotions, and develop a more balanced perspective.
  4. Visualization: Use visualization techniques to imagine positive outcomes and build confidence in your abilities.

Maintaining Healthy Boundaries in Relationships

Establishing and maintaining healthy boundaries in relationships is crucial for overcoming insecurity and fostering emotional stability. Clearly communicate your needs, values, and limits to others, and assert yourself when boundaries are crossed. Respect others’ boundaries as well and prioritize self-care and well-being in all relationships. Setting and enforcing boundaries can help you feel safe, respected, and empowered in your interactions with others.
